In 2023, the Raw Sugar Equivalent market size volume in Norway stood at 142.30 Thousand Metric Tons. Based on the forecasted data, the market is expected to exhibit a steady declining trend from 2024 onwards. Specifically:
- In 2024, the volume is forecasted to be 141.11 Thousand Metric Tons, reflecting a -0.84% decline year-on-year compared to 2023.
- In 2025, the volume is anticipated to decrease further to 140.43 Thousand Metric Tons, showing a year-on-year variation of -0.48%.
- In 2026, the volume is projected to reach 139.76 Thousand Metric Tons, marking a -0.48% decline year-on-year.
- By 2027, the volume is expected to be 139.11 Thousand Metric Tons, indicating a -0.47% yearly decrease.
- In 2028, the forecasted volume is 138.46 Thousand Metric Tons, with a -0.47% year-on-year decline.
Over the five-year period from 2023 to 2028, the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) for the market is approximately -0.54%, signifying a gradual but consistent reduction in market size volume.
